"""WebSocket Connection Manager""" from typing import Dict, Set, Optional from fastapi import WebSocket import redis.asyncio as redis from app.core.config import settings class ConnectionManager: """Manages WebSocket connections""" def __init__(self): self.active_connections: Dict[str, Set[WebSocket]] = {} # user_id -> connections self.channel_subscriptions: Dict[str, Set[WebSocket]] = {} self.websocket_channels: Dict[WebSocket, Set[str]] = {} self.redis_client: Optional[redis.Redis] = None async def connect(self, websocket: WebSocket, user_id: str): await websocket.accept() if user_id not in self.active_connections: self.active_connections[user_id] = set() self.active_connections[user_id].add(websocket) if self.redis_client is None: redis_url = settings.REDIS_URL if redis_url.startswith("redis://"): self.redis_client = redis.from_url(redis_url, decode_responses=True) else: self.redis_client = redis.Redis( host=settings.REDIS_SERVER, port=settings.REDIS_PORT, db=settings.REDIS_DB, decode_responses=True, ) def disconnect(self, websocket: WebSocket, user_id: str): if user_id in self.active_connections: self.active_connections[user_id].discard(websocket) if not self.active_connections[user_id]: del self.active_connections[user_id] self.unsubscribe_all(websocket) def subscribe(self, websocket: WebSocket, channels: list[str]): normalized_channels = { str(channel).strip() for channel in channels if str(channel).strip() } if not normalized_channels: return socket_channels = self.websocket_channels.setdefault(websocket, set()) for channel in normalized_channels: self.channel_subscriptions.setdefault(channel, set()).add(websocket) socket_channels.add(channel) def unsubscribe(self, websocket: WebSocket, channels: list[str]): for channel in {str(channel).strip() for channel in channels if str(channel).strip()}: subscribers = self.channel_subscriptions.get(channel) if subscribers is not None: subscribers.discard(websocket) if not subscribers: del self.channel_subscriptions[channel] socket_channels = self.websocket_channels.get(websocket) if socket_channels is not None: socket_channels.discard(channel) if not socket_channels: del self.websocket_channels[websocket] def unsubscribe_all(self, websocket: WebSocket): channels = list(self.websocket_channels.get(websocket, set())) if channels: self.unsubscribe(websocket, channels) async def send_personal_message(self, message: dict, user_id: str): if user_id in self.active_connections: for connection in self.active_connections[user_id]: try: await connection.send_json(message) except Exception: pass async def broadcast(self, message: dict, channel: str = "all"): if channel == "all": for user_id in self.active_connections: await self.send_personal_message(message, user_id) else: for connection in list(self.channel_subscriptions.get(channel, set())): try: await connection.send_json(message) except Exception: self.unsubscribe_all(connection) async def close_all(self): for user_id in self.active_connections: for connection in self.active_connections[user_id]: await connection.close() self.active_connections.clear() self.channel_subscriptions.clear() self.websocket_channels.clear() manager = ConnectionManager() async def get_websocket_manager() -> ConnectionManager: return manager
